Message type: E = Error
Message class: LR - CATS: Cross-Application Time Sheet
Message number: 239
Message text: Error occurred during conversion
You are working with customer-defined additional fields. Conversions
are required to represent the field contents on the screen. An error
has occurred with the conversions, probably a programming error.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.
Contact the SAP hotline.

- Error occurred during conversion ?The SAP error message LR239, which states "Error occurred during conversion," typically occurs during data processing or conversion tasks in SAP systems. This error can arise in various contexts, such as during data uploads, conversions, or when processing certain transactions. Here are some common causes, potential solutions, and related information for this error:
Causes:
- Data Format Issues: The data being processed may not be in the expected format. This can include incorrect data types, invalid characters, or unexpected null values.
- Conversion Routine Errors: If a custom conversion routine is being used, there may be an error in the logic or implementation of that routine.
- Incompatible Data Types: Attempting to convert data between incompatible types (e.g., trying to convert a string to a date without proper formatting).
- Missing or Incorrect Configuration: Configuration settings related to data conversion may be missing or incorrectly set up.
- System or Memory Issues: Insufficient system resources or memory can also lead to conversion errors.
Solutions:
- Check Data Formats: Review the data being processed to ensure it adheres to the expected formats. Validate that all required fields are populated correctly.
- Review Conversion Routines: If custom conversion routines are in use, check the code for any logical errors or exceptions that may be causing the failure.
- Debugging: Use debugging tools in SAP to trace the execution of the program or transaction that is generating the error. This can help identify the exact point of failure.
- Configuration Review: Ensure that all relevant configuration settings are correctly set up. This may involve checking settings in transaction codes like SPRO or other relevant configuration areas.
- Check System Resources: Monitor system performance and resource usage. If the system is low on memory or processing power, consider optimizing performance or increasing resources.
- S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address this specific error. SAP frequently releases updates and patches that can resolve known issues.
